Output e55fd229c979b6a9b714275de553b1e576a0e0ffec4618b7f68749597ae13ac0:66

value
6692396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e74074c174c7c26eaf31333f3701a143359dcb96 OP_EQUAL
address
MUyuYEH8x31AC5G898CfrSm4ewEh78PPcg
transaction
e55fd229c979b6a9b714275de553b1e576a0e0ffec4618b7f68749597ae13ac0
spent
true